Description of problem: It would be nice if abrt could detect when a bug has an update pending and direct people to the update *before* adding them CC. Version-Release number of selected component (if applicable): abrt-2.0.10-4.fc17 How reproducible: always Steps to Reproduce: 1. watch a very popular ABRT bug 2. wait for an update to fix it Actual results: Even though there is an update available in updates-testing already, users continue to report the bug and get added CC. This is annoying because one receives notifications. In bug 734442 an update was issues one week ago, but still more than 20 people reported the bug again. Expected results: It would be cool if ABRT could display something along the lines of "Good news, there already is an update available for your problem. Do you want to install it now? [Y] / [n]" Pressing Y would then automatically start packagekit with the updates-testing repo enabled and install the update. How awesome would that be?
ABRT already search bodhi for pending updates and if there is an update referencing the bug it suggest updating. If it doesn't catch this one it's probably a bug.
